While embedded systems strive to cram ever more intelligence into smaller spaces, power has direct implications on the size, cooling and mobility of any system. That makes AC-DC power supplies critical enablers for meeting today’s needs. To meet those needs, AC-DC power supply vendors continue to roll out more efficient products, new cooling strategies and more compact solutions. In tandem to those trends, there’s a growing demand to reduce size, weight and power of system electronics. Driving those demands is a desire to fit more functionality in the same space or into a smaller footprint.
In recent years, there’s been a trend in AC-DC power supply products that have some sort of application or industry focus. Although that trend hasn’t diminished, many of the new products released over the past 12 months are moving in a multipurpose direction. We’re seeing supplies that offer certifications and features that span multiple applications like medical, industrial and networking (Figure 1).
FIGURE 1 Many of the new AC-DC power supplies released in the past year are moving in a multipurpose direction. We’re seeing supplies that offer certifications and features that span multiple applications such as medical, industrial and networking.
Exemplifying this trend, RECOM’s RACM1200-V series of AC-DC powers supplies offer a wide output voltage adjustment range and a combination of constant current limitation and hiccup mode settings. All these features make the product multipurpose, says RECOM. The product also holds worldwide safety files to medical, industrial and ITE standards along with electromagnetic compatibility compliance with class A immunity and class B emissions.

The 600W IHC600 from Calex is a new series of AC-DC harsh environment industrial power supplies. The IHC series is aimed at ruggedized and special applications that require operation in extreme industrial environmental conditions. The product enclosure is an IP66 sealed convection/conduction cooled assembly that can be baseplate mounted to a thermal (cold) plate or natural convection cooled.
• Universal AC input 100VAC to 240VAC
• Single 12V, 24V and 48V output
• -5%/+15% output voltage adjustment
• Up to 600W conduction cooled,
no fan at +85°C max.
• High efficiency of 95%
• Active PFC meets
EN61000-3-2 class A
• Active inrush current protection
• RoHS3 Directive 2015/863 compliant
The PQU650 series from Murata Power Solutions are open-frame, 650W-rated AC-DC power supplies. They offer high power-density, with forced air- and convection-cooled ambient ratings. Features include wide output voltage adjustment range, auxiliary power rails and a high transient capability. Measuring just 6″ × 4″ by 1U high, the power supplies accept a universal AC input voltage range of 90VAC to 264VAC.
• AC input voltage range of 90VAC to 264VAC
• Meets 2x MOPP primary to secondary, and 1x MOPP primary to chassis
• Output ratings from 12V to 54V,
and 12.1A to 54.2A
• High 450W convection-cooled rating
• Efficiency levels of up to 95%
• Dimensions: 6″ × 4″ by 1U high

The RACM1200-V series from RECOM features a special baseplate cooled design supports heat transfer to allow up to 1000W continuous output power. Up to 1200W output power is available for up to 10 seconds and in boost mode operation or for extended time with sufficient system airflow through the unit. Wide output voltage adjustment range, constant current limitation and hiccup mode settings make the product multipurpose.
• Up to 1000W fan-less power
/ 1200W boost
• Designed and made in Europe
• Efficiency exceeding 90% from
15% load
• Operating temperature
-40°C to +80°C
• Certified to Industrial and medical standards
• Analog control and monitor function
• Dimensions L×W×H:
228.0mm × 96.2mm × 40.0mm
3-Phase 4080W Supply Supports Delta and Wye Inputs
The TDK-Lambda brand TPS4000-48 power supply extends TDK’s the existing 3kW to 4kW rated TPS series. Delivering up to 4080W output power (48V at 83.3A) in a 2U high package, the TPS4000 series operates from a wide range Delta or Wye 350 – 528VAC three phase input. This industrial power supply is ideal for use in many applications including test and measurement equipment, IC fabrication and more.
• Suitable for 400/440/480VAC 3-phase Delta and Wye inputs
• Compact 2U high package size
• 92% efficient
• PMBus interface for remote programming and monitoring
• Certified to IEC/EN/UL/CSA 62368-1
• Dimensions: 107mm × 84.4mm × 335mm
• Weight: 4kg
• 55% load at 70°C
XP Power’s HDL3000-HV series of single-phase input 3kW AC-DC power supplies provide output voltages from 150V to 400VDC, with up to 800VDC realized by connecting units in series. All models feature output voltage and current adjustment ranging from 0 to 105% using analog (via voltage or resistance) or digital (I2C, RS485 and RS232) interfaces enabling the user to tailor the power solution to the application.
• Programmable output voltage
(0-105%) and current (0-105%)
• Nominal output voltages 150/200/250/300/400VDC
• 90VAC to 264VAC input
• ITE safety agency approvals
• Class A conducted and radiated emissions
• High efficiency, up to 93%
• Intelligent fan speed control
• Digital protocol: I²C
• -20°C to +60°C operating temperature
